Galaxy Digital's Helios campus has crossed from capital formation to operational delivery. Multiple sources now confirm the Texas Bitcoin mining site's name as 'Helios,' with Clayco serving as the construction firm[1] and Yahoo Finance reporting that Galaxy has delivered its first AI data center at the campus.[2] The Block[3] and CryptoRank[4] provide additional confirmation of the $460M capital structure, while Stockquest frames this as Galaxy becoming a 'Neo Cloud' in 2026 — positioning it alongside CoreWeave as a new class of AI compute provider built on repurposed crypto infrastructure.[5] This operational milestone shifts the miner-to-AI story from institutional capital formation to actual compute delivery, elevating Galaxy from research validator and capital deployer to full operator in the same AI compute market as the companies in Situational Awareness LP's portfolio.

The most materially significant development this cycle is the emergence of Bloom Energy as a named specific position with specific dollar figures. Yahoo Finance reports that Aschenbrenner 'turned $875 million into $2.2 billion via Bloom Energy Stock,'[6] providing the first publicly cited capital deployment and return figures for an individual named holding outside the broadly-known Bitcoin miner basket. Bloom Energy (ticker: BE) manufactures solid oxide fuel cells for on-site power generation at data centers and industrial facilities — its inclusion aligns with the AI-power-infrastructure thesis at a more granular layer than grid utilities or mining infrastructure, targeting the actual power generation units serving large compute facilities. A ~2.5x return on $875M implies this was among the primary return drivers, and reframes what the thesis actually is: if $875M was deployed in Bloom Energy alone, the fund's concentration in that single non-mining infrastructure name rivals its total exposure to the Bitcoin miner basket, shifting the narrative characterization from 'Bitcoin miner pivot play' to 'power infrastructure broadly.' Timeline

  • 2024-06: Aschenbrenner publishes 'Situational Awareness,' a 165-page manifesto predicting AGI by 2027 and framing the GPT-2 to GPT-4 leap as proof of exponential AI progress [70][102][71][103][104]
  • 2024-07-02: Bill Gates publicly disagrees with Aschenbrenner's AGI-this-decade thesis in Fortune, representing early high-profile institutional skepticism of the manifesto's core timeline [105]
  • 2024: Aschenbrenner launches Situational Awareness LP with approximately $225 million in seed capital; initial Bitcoin miner position reported at approximately $100 million [95][67][71][106]
  • 2025-05: Daniel Scrivner publishes Q1 2025 trades and holdings analysis for Situational Awareness LP, providing an early portfolio window predating the Q4 2025 chip-exit rotation [21]
  • 2025-06: Fund reports approximately 47% returns in H1 2025, significantly outperforming broad markets [107]
  • 2025-10-08: Bernstein Research publishes analysis identifying Bitcoin miners as key AI infrastructure partners amid power crunch; independently predicts IREN pivot to $3.7B AI cloud business [43][44][45]
  • 2025-10-08: Fortune publishes profile detailing how Aschenbrenner turned a 'viral AI prophecy into profit'; fund valued at approximately $1.5 billion at time of publication [96][108][109]
  • 2025-11-06: IREN reports Q1 FY26 results (quarter ending September 2025), establishing a pre-Microsoft-contract baseline ahead of the Q2 FY26 GPU financing announcement [16][17]
  • 2025-Q4: Situational Awareness LP exits chip giant positions and scales the compute infrastructure layer, per mlq.ai analysis of Q4 2025 13F filing; Daniel Scrivner publishes independent Q4 2025 trades and holdings analysis as a second portfolio intelligence window [60][61][63][64]
  • 2025-12-29: The Economist publishes 'OpenAI faces a make-or-break year in 2026,' adding a major institutional voice to the question of whether the AGI timeline thesis is on track [110]
  • 2026-02: S&P Global Market Intelligence publishes 'Bitcoin miners pivot to AI and HPC as cryptocurrency market slumps,' becoming the third major institutional research provider to validate the miner/AI infrastructure thesis [80]
  • 2026-02-05: IREN Reports Q2 FY26 Results: $3.6B GPU financing secured for Microsoft contract, 140k GPU fleet expansion, $3.4B ARR target by end of 2026 confirmed; covered by GlobeNewswire, Seeking Alpha, Yahoo Finance, MSN, and a YouTube earnings analysis [49][50][51][52][53][54][18]
  • 2026-02: Bernstein hikes Bitcoin miner price targets as AI infrastructure play; IREN thesis extended to MEXC News, MSN, The Block, and Investing.com audiences; Investing.com adopts escalated 'winning the AI Data Center Arms Race' framing [46][47][48][19][20]
  • 2026-02: Wall Street analysts cut price targets on Cipher Mining (CIFR) and TeraWulf (WULF), introducing within-sector differentiation as execution quality diverges among miners [76]
  • 2026-02: CoinShares publishes Bitcoin Mining Report Q1 2026, providing systematic sector data on hash rate, profitability, and AI hosting pivot across the mining industry [111][112][113][114]
  • 2026-02-11: 13F filing date per GuruFocus; Situational Awareness LP's quarterly holdings become public regulatory record, tracked across GuruFocus, Quiver Quantitative, Pablo Stafforini's notes, and Trendlyne (March 2026 portfolio) [99][115][116][61][62][63][65]
  • 2026-03-05: Fortune reports on fund's strategy betting on power companies and Bitcoin miners as AI infrastructure plays; AUM described at multi-billion scale [95]

  • The Bloom Energy reveal ($875M → $2.2B, item 6857) reframes the fund's thesis as 'power infrastructure broadly' rather than 'Bitcoin miners to AI.' If a fuel cell manufacturer was a primary named winning trade rather than a Bitcoin miner, the viral 'bet on Bitcoin miners' narrative is partially misleading — and raises questions about whether the thesis was prescient about AI power demand generically, or specifically about miner-to-AI conversions as the investment vehicle [6][95][67][75][59]
  • Galaxy Digital's Helios delivery (item 6517) transforms Galaxy from an institutional co-investor in the same thesis to a direct operational competitor in the AI compute market — meaning the companies Situational Awareness LP holds (IREN and others) now face competition from Galaxy, which entered with nine-figure capital and has already delivered capacity. Thesis-validation and competitive-threat dynamics are now simultaneous for the same entity [2][3][1][5][22][25][49]
  • Eli Lifland's truncated tweet (item 6708) signals the AI 2027 framework is being publicly revised, while Aschenbrenner's 2024 manifesto has not been publicly updated. If the most comparable AI timeline prediction framework is walking back its 2027 confidence, the investment thesis grounded in a 2027 AGI timeline faces an implicit legitimacy question — yet the fund's financial returns are already substantially realized regardless of whether the AGI prediction proves correct [10][40][41][38][39]
  • Galaxy Digital's $460M capital raise to convert a Texas Bitcoin mine to AI data center marks a structural shift: the miner/AI pivot thesis is no longer the exclusive domain of Situational Awareness LP or a research-stage idea — a major institutional capital allocator is now executing and delivering the same trade. This raises the question of whether the thesis is now crowded and whether returns for earlier entrants like Aschenbrenner will compress as institutional competition intensifies [22][23][25][95][43][46][2]
